ABC’s of Blood Stain Pattern Documentation
This course will provide training and assistance in the proper recognition, documentation, and collection of bloodstain pattern evidence. The ultimate purpose of learning the correct procedures for documenting and collecting bloodstain evidence is for later reconstruction of events at the crime scene.
Course topics include: Safety at the crime scene when dealing with Biological Evidence; Equipment Needs for the Bloodstain Documentation Kit; Photography of Bloodstain Patterns; Video Recording the Bloodstain Pattern Scene; Bloodstain Pattern Sketching Techniques; On Scene Presumptive Blood Testing to include Species On Scene Testing; Blood Detection Techniques, Bloodstain Terminology; Report Writing and Court Room Testimony presenting bloodstain pattern evidence. The students will work with mock items of evidence for blood detection and documentation of patterns. Furthermore, the students will work mock crime scenes for blood evidence and test and document the patterns within these mock scenes. The students will issue reports concerning the forensic facts within the mock scenes utilizing proper bloodstain terminology.
